Campground
Located at the entrance of the Historical village along the Ouiatchouan River, the campground includes 175 sites set up in wooded areas. Whether the site is located near the river or closer to the welcome area, campers have access to:


  • Sanitary facilities
  • Picnic tables
  • Two small laundry facilities
  • Dumping station
  • Free wireless Internet Access (Wi-Fi)
  • Ice
  • Public phone


A new concept, the "lean to", is also available starting this year! It consists of a wooden platform (10 x 9 foot) with three walls and a roof to protect the tent, camping materials and picnic table in case of bad weather.

The services offered are suitable for all type of campers:
61 sites equipped with three services (water, electricity and sewage).
30 sites equipped with two services.
91 sites with no services (few of them with "lean to").

175 sites in all.
Pets on a leash are accepted at the camping only.

Mini-cottages
This economical formula, half way between the motel and campground, will appeal to young families who enjoy the great outdoors!

Built for four people, these 3.6 m x 4.3 m mini-cottages (12 ft x 14 ft) are electrically heated. They come equipped with a kitchen including a 2-ring stove, mini-fridge and sink. Dishes and cutlery are provided but you’ll need to rent or bring your own bedding for the length of your stay. Sanitary facilities are located at about 45 m (150 ft) from the cottages.
